Latitude electronic parking brake failure
Summary of the thread
A 2011 Renault Latitude owner is experiencing an electronic parking brake failure, indicated by a warning light and error memory fault. The suspected cause is a defective electric motor in the brake caliper. Another owner suggests that it could also be a faulty brake switch or system glitch and recommends a professional diagnostic check. Ultimately, replacing the motor in the caliper may be necessary to resolve the issue.
